The Rangers support remains one of the most passionate and loyal fanbases in world football, creating a unique atmosphere at Ibrox and following the club across Scotland and Europe. Every matchday brings new stories, debates and talking points shaped by the fans themselves.

From reaction to recent performances to wider discussions on the direction of the squad and the demands of competing for silverware, the Rangers community continues to play a defining role in shaping the club's identity.

Rangers Academy, Youth Development & Future Prospects

Rangers continue to invest heavily in youth development, producing players who contribute at first-team level and represent the club in European competition. The pathway from the Rangers Academy to Ibrox remains a central pillar of the club’s long-term vision.
